This Year's Honorees
This year, the inductees include a mix of perennial favorites and up-and-coming stars, each bringing their unique voice and experience to the legacy of Appalachian music.
- Susie McNally: A folk singer whose haunting melodies have captivated audiences, McNally's work pays homage to the traditions of Blue Ridge while infusing it with contemporary storytelling.
- James “Jim” Elliott: Best known for his pioneering role in bluegrass music, Elliott's influence can be felt in the countless musicians who cite him as a formative inspiration.
- Patricia Lake: Known for her poignant lyrics and soulful performances, Lake's contributions highlight the emotional depth that roots music can achieve.
